Origins and Definition of Claret Red
Claret Red derives its name from the popular red wines produced in the Bordeaux region of France, specifically from the vineyards of the ancient city of Bordeaux. The term "claret" originally referred to the pale red hue of these wines, but over time, it has come to represent a darker and deeper shade of red. Claret Red combines the intensity of red with the subtle hints of purple or burgundy, resulting in a color that exudes sophistication and elegance. It is often associated with prestige, luxury, and refinement.
Claret Red in Art and Design
In the realm of art and design, Claret Red has been widely utilized to evoke strong emotions and create impactful visual compositions. Renaissance painters often employed this hue to signify power, wealth, and nobility in their portraits. The deep and warm tone of Claret Red adds depth and intensity to any artistic creation, making it a favored choice for dramatic expressions. In design, Claret Red is often used as an accent color for its ability to create a striking contrast against lighter shades, adding a touch of drama and sophistication to interior spaces or fashion collections.

Symbolism and Cultural Significance of Claret Red
Claret Red carries symbolic meanings that transcend cultures and time periods. In Western cultures, this color is often associated with power, wealth, and prestige. It symbolizes authority and is frequently used to represent royalty and nobility. In Chinese culture, Claret Red is associated with luck, happiness, and celebration. It is a popular color choice for festive occasions such as weddings and New Year celebrations.
